Gabriel Willow is an environmental educator, an ecologist, and an urban naturalist who lives and works in New York City. In particular Willow is known for his birding tours and city wildlife (or city "wilderness") tours, which he has lead since 1999, through the parks, gardens, and waterways of New York City. As an educator he is a self-described "storyteller".Willow lives with a group of roommates in a brownstone in Brooklyn; they attempt to live in an environmentally sustainable way.
